Summary
Predicted to enable fibroblast growth factor binding activity; fibroblast growth factor-activated receptor activity; and heparin binding activity. Involved in several processes, including cholesterol homeostasis; phosphate ion homeostasis; and regulation of bile acid biosynthetic process. Acts upstream of or within several processes, including alveolar secondary septum development; negative regulation of fibroblast growth factor production; and positive regulation of parathyroid hormone secretion. Predicted to be located in several cellular components, including Golgi apparatus; endoplasmic reticulum; and transport vesicle. Predicted to be part of receptor complex. Predicted to be integral component of plasma membrane. Predicted to colocalize with cell-cell junction. Is expressed in several structures, including alimentary system; brain; genitourinary system; musculoskeletal system; and sensory organ. Human ortholog(s) of this gene implicated in carcinoma (multiple); liver cirrhosis; prostate cancer; and stomach cancer. Orthologous to human FGFR4 (fibroblast growth factor receptor 4).
